💡 Tips
- Same is the gateway to Mkomazi National Park, famous for its rhino sanctuary.
- Hike in the Pare Mountains to explore traditional villages and lush forests.
- On clear days, you can spot Mount Kilimanjaro in the distance from the town edge.
- Ensure you use a 4x4 vehicle if you plan to drive into the mountain trails.
- Visit the local market to buy the highly-regarded Pare mountain honey.

Same is the administrative capital of the Same District in the Kilimanjaro Region of northern Tanzania. The town is strategically located at the foot of the South Pare Mountains and serves as a vital commercial hub for the surrounding agricultural highlands. Historically, the settlement grew significantly following the construction of the Usambara Railway in the early 20th century, which linked the port of Tanga to the interior. The region is currently renowned for the large-scale production of ginger and sisal, as well as livestock farming practiced by the indigenous Pare people. Positioned along the major highway connecting Dar es Salaam and Arusha, Same acts as a crucial transit point for travelers and logistics. The nearby Mkomazi National Park has increased the town's importance as a gateway for ecotourism and wildlife conservation efforts. Geographically, the urban area is defined by its dramatic mountain backdrop, which dictates the local microclimate and water management systems.

Best time to visit & climate
The most pleasant time to visit is Jun–Aug.
| Jan | Feb | Mar | Apr | May | Jun | Jul | Aug | Sep | Oct | Nov | Dec |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Avg °C | 25 | 25 | 25 | 23 | 22 | 21 | 21 | 22 | 23 | 24 | 24 | 24 |
| Rain mm | 67 | 55 | 87 | 109 | 69 | 14 | 9 | 11 | 15 | 52 | 91 | 90 |

Facts
- The town is situated at an average elevation of approximately 890 meters above sea level.
- Same is a primary producer of ginger in Tanzania, supplying both domestic and Kenyan markets.
- The Usambara Railway reached the settlement around 1910 during the German colonial era.
- Mkomazi National Park, located nearby, is famous for its black rhino sanctuary.
- The local climate varies from semi-arid to sub-humid due to the influence of the Pare Mountains.
- The town serves as the headquarters for the Roman Catholic Diocese of Same.
